Countryside Veterinary Service Professional Veterinary Services for Life. An Equine Medical and Surgery Practice.

Offering proactive veterinary care for your equine family member including:
*Performance Pre-Purchase Exams
*Digital X-rays and Digital Ultrasounds
*Lameness Evaluations
*Shock Wave Therapy- tendon and ligament injuries, back and joint problems
* Ultrasound guided injections, PRP, Pro-Stride, IRAP, Stem cell Therapy
*Reproductive Services- including artificial insemination, shipped semen (fresh o

r frozen), and on-site mare/foal care while mare is bred
*Dentistry- including intra-oral dental x-rays, corrective, and maintenance
*Haul-In Facility For Exams- round pen and arena surface available for lunging and riding exams
*Therapeutic Shoeing Prescriptions
*Top Quality Medical Practices- including the most current treatments and up to date protocols
*Professional and Compassionate Services

New updates on currently issued EECVIs (6-month Health certificates).

URGENT UPDATE: EECVI Permits for Equine Travel Temporarily Suspended

Due to a multi-state EHV outbreak linked to equine events, states are no longer accepting EECVI movement permits for horses.

✋ Do NOT issue new EECVIs
✅ GVL CVIs are still accepted and can be used instead
📞 Contact the destination state animal health officials before ANY equine movement
⚠️ Additional restrictions may be in place

We'll update you when EECVI movement permits are accepted again. Thank you for helping protect equine health during this outbreak.

Good Morning
We are aware of the EHV in Texas and Oklahoma. The Washington State Veterinarian’s Office is coordinating with the affected states and are currently awaiting to receive trace information from Texas and Oklahoma. If they receive traces from the other states, they will contact those owners directly and issue State Hold Orders to mitigate further spread of the disease.
